Self Healing, what is it, how does it relate to your DNA?

Self Healing, what is it? How is it related to the information stored in your DNA? Subtitles available in several languages using Youtube’s Closed Caption features.

Subscribe to our VIP Club

Subscribe to our VIP Club to receive an instant coupon code, plus future discounts which are not published on our website!

Comments are closed.